Normally, the UC campuses use a special URL for PubMed<http://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ed?tool=cdl&otool=cdlotool> which automatically displays the UC-eLinks button in the search results records to easily link to the online article (if applicable), to check the print journal holdings on a campus, or to request the article via Interlibrary Loan (ILL) services.

At the present time, the UC-eLinks button is not displaying in the PubMed search results records.  CDL has notified PubMed customer support about this problem but they currently do not have an estimation of when the problem will be resolved.
